A shocking case of murder has surfaced in Uttar Pradesh’s Auraiya, where a 25-year-old man was allegedly killed by a contract killer hired by his wife and her lover just 15 days after their marriage, police said on Monday.
The victim, Dilip Yadav, was found injured in a field on March 19 after the police received information about his condition. He was rushed to a community health centre in Bidhuna, but due to his critical state, he was shifted to Saifai hospital, then to Gwalior and Agra for further treatment. However, as his condition continued to deteriorate, he was finally admitted to a hospital in Auraiya, where he succumbed to his injuries on the night of March 21.
The police investigation led to the arrest of 22-year-old Pragati Yadav (the victim’s wife), her lover Anurag alias Manoj, and the contract killer Ramji Chaudhary. The three accused were identified through CCTV footage and tracked down. According to Superintendent of Police Abhijith R Shankar, Pragati and Anurag hatched the murder plot and paid ₹2 lakh to Chaudhary to execute the crime.
This case has gained attention amid another disturbing murder case in Uttar Pradesh’s Meerut, where a woman, along with her lover, brutally killed her husband, chopped his body, and hid it in a cement-filled drum. The accused, Muskan Rastogi and Sahil Shukla, are currently lodged in prison and undergoing treatment for drug addiction.
